I agree.  I'm fond of the Dark Forces games that spawned this ship, but the basic shape and structure was a result of the extremely limited rendering power of the day and age it came from.  I think it would be a neat piece of history to get the ship in game, but probably with a fair amount of re-imagining compared to the usual depictions of it.

I suggest you take some inspiration from the basic ship and the available paintings/renderings, and then go wild with it and make it your own in the best spirit of our nu- series of EU ships.  Take a look at Brand-X's work for some more ideas on what can be done - the Z-95 and E-Wing are both some of the best examples of this sort of thing.  Try and consider this thing being a real ship and the design consequences of how it is currently and how to improve it.

Tucked away landing gear are pretty common so not sure that would be a big design concern, but if you come up with something interesting I'd love to see it.  The engine pylons specifically are something that could benefit from attention.  And the hull could maybe be broken up into more than four planes.  Maybe narrowing between sections like the cockpit and the rest of the hull to give it more of a neck appearance.  And yeah, anything that can be borrowed from the YT series to give it a more consistent feel in the CEC line, maybe some window designs or a much more broken up hull, that still conforms to the general silhouette.  Basically, I wouldn't be afraid to go greeble crazy, there won't ever be more than one on screen at a time.
